"THE FUTURE SUCKS, but Jim, Jason and Joseph intend to change that!" — Each week these three brave pop culture agents (a.k.a. The Crispy Coated Robots) receive orders from the home office in the far-off radioactive future requesting they submit individual Top 5 lists on various predetermined mundane topics about the late 20th and early 21st centuries.
